Breaking Down the Features of Whatman Nytran SuPerCharge and Nylon Membranes, Whatman 10416296 Nytran Supercharge Nylon Membrane Rolls
Specifications
- Dimensions: The 30 cm x 3 m roll offers ample material for numerous blotting experiments, making it a cost-effective solution for high-throughput labs. This generous size allows for efficient use of membrane, minimizing waste.
- Pore Size: The 0.45 µm pore size is ideal for most standard blotting applications, ensuring efficient transfer of nucleic acids and proteins. This pore size strikes a balance between retaining target molecules and minimizing non-specific binding.
- Whatman No.: The product is easily identifiable with the number 10416296, which ensures easy reordering and tracking. This number simplifies communication and avoids confusion when ordering.
- Membrane Type: Nytran SuPerCharge Nylon Membrane with a very high positive charge for enhanced binding. The positively charged membrane is key to its ability to bind negatively charged molecules.
